About the role
This role will report to the Director of Information Technology and will start out as a dual-purpose position; initially, you will be deeply involved in day-to-day support, troubleshooting, ticket resolution, and continual process improvement. As the team quickly matures, you will help to recruit and manage a team of helpdesk technicians to manage the ticket workload. You will help to develop and own SLAs, KPIs, SOPs, troubleshooting runbooks, and escalation pathways, working to define and deliver enterprise-level technical support and service management to the company. This role is ideal for someone who thrives in a fast-paced, hybrid work environment and can bring both technical depth and a solid background in leading service desk operations.
Responsibilities
- Help to recruit, train, and manage a team of IT support technicians and/or contractors with the goal of providing Enterprise-class support ticket resolution.
- Own day-to-day helpdesk operations including ticket intake, triage, prioritization, and resolution via an ITSM platform.
- Define, track and report KPIs and SLA performance to Technology leadership; lead continuous improvement work based on data.
- Diagnose and resolve a wide range of end-user technical issues remotely and/or on-site.
- Serve as the escalation point for complex, sensitive, or executive-level issues.
- Maintain a positive and service-oriented attitude; respond to customer needs in a professional and timely manner.
- Work at least one week per month on-call, and respond to occasional after-hours incidents as required.
- Drive to site locations and travel domestically (15-20%).
- Manage enterprise-wide collaboration platforms (Microsoft 365 and/or Google Workspace), including user provisioning, licensing, security, and troubleshooting.
- Manage endpoints via MDM/UEM across Windows and Mac environments, with hands-on experience in Microsoft Intune / Endpoint Manager or equivalent.
- Triage and resolve endpoint compliance alerts and policy violations via MDM software.
- Provide tier 2/3 support for Slack, Salesforce, NetSuite and other firm-wide SaaS offerings.
- Create and maintain IT documentation, SOPs, and self-service knowledge resources for staff.
- Identify recurring issues and drive root cause resolution to reduce ticket volume.
- Collaborate with the tech team to build and maintain a user-facing helpdesk knowledge base.
- Collaborate with the Director of Information Technology on tooling decisions, service delivery, infrastructure projects, and strategic operational improvements.
- Provide on-site support for company office locations in El Segundo, North Hollywood, Burbank, and Chatsworth.
- Provide remote support for company manufacturing locations in Wisconsin and Nebraska.
- Assist with other duties and projects as assigned.
Requirements
- 3-5+ years of IT support or IT operations experience, with at least 1-2+ years in a technical lead, manager, or senior-level operational capacity.
- Proven SLA ownership and KPI reporting across a helpdesk or service desk function.
- Experience troubleshooting computers, printers/MFPs, basic network connectivity issues, computer peripherals, tablets, and mobile devices.
- Operational understanding of IT security fundamentals: MFA, principles of least-privilege access, RBAC, endpoint hygiene, phishing defense.
- Experience with Jira Service Management (JSM) or a comparable ITSM platform.
- Ability to operate independently in a hybrid, remote or distributed environment with minimal supervision.
- Proficient in Microsoft 365 and/or Google Workspace management (Email, Collaboration, Cloud File Storage) or equivalent enterprise collaboration platform.
- Valid California driver's license, with a good driving record and 3 years of driving history.
- Able to lift 50 lbs. safely on a regular basis and move computers, printers and other equipment.
- Strong written and verbal communication skills; comfortable supporting and presenting to executive stakeholders.
